If Ksp for HgSO₄ is 6.4 x 10⁻⁵, then solubility of the salt is
Options
(a) 6.4 x 10⁻⁵
(b) 8 x 10⁻³
(c) 6.4 x 10⁻³
(d) 8 x 10⁻⁶
Correct Answer:
8 x 10⁻³
